Greetings to All,

 

The next Mt. Edge council meeting will be held Friday April 5th at 7PM. 

 Why the date and time change? Several Shire members (including some of the officers) have found the Sunday meetings a challenge to attend. Therefore we decided to have the meetings on the first Friday evening of every month this year.

We hope eventually to be able to combine the Shire council meetings with a monthly A&S informal gathering that would run from 6PM - 9PM. 

Meeting location: we have the Coffee Cottage Cafe meeting room reserved from 6PM - 9PM, The address is 808 E. Hancock Street, Newberg OR 97132. The Coffee Cottage Web site (www.coffeecottagecafe.net/contact.php) has a diagram of the meeting room location (a separate building from the main cafe). Hancock St. is 99W south through downtown Newberg - parking can be a challenge but some is available on-street. Look for the SCA folding sign in front of the entrance to the meeting room building.

We can order coffee and other menu items from the cafe and enjoy them in the room, and A&S projects like sewing and scribal (with protection for the meeting room table) are welcome. Let the cafe know you are part of the meeting - any food we order decreases the cost of the meeting room.

 

Garb optional for council meetings.

 As always, everyone is invited to attend Shire council meetings, Shire residents and neighboring friends included.

Equestrian-ArcherMonthly Archery and Equestrian practices for 2013 - Next Practice Is 5/4/2013!

The next Mountain Edge Archery and Equestrian Practice is Saturday May 4. Morning will be target archery in the indoor arena. Loaner target archery gear is available - beginners are welcome! Horses are in the afternoon. No prior equestrian authorizations are required for the Saturday equestrian activities - ground crew class and authorizations are available. Contact Macha (macha(at)dragonsden.com) with questions. THIS SATURDAY PART OF THE AFTERNOON EQUESTRIAN PRACTICE OVERLAPS WITH A BOOK RELEASE PARTY FOR A FELLOW SCADIAN - DURING PRACTICE INSURANCE TIMES ALL FOLKS COMING TO THE BOOK RELEASE PARTY MUST SIGN THE SCA FORMS.

The entire site is an equestrian area - everyone entering gate must sign the equestrian waiver in addition to any other required SCA waivers. Parents must accompany their minor or send properly executed waivers with the designated adult. The parent or legal guardian must be present for the minor to actively participate in equestrian activites. Please contact Macha if you have questions about waivers.
